Utilizations of ecological energetic sources
FAST-BR55Acad. year: 2016/2017
CR and EU legislation on renewable energy sources.
The use of Hydropower and residual gradient.
The use of biomass, geothermal energy, marine energy.
The use of wind energy.
The use of solar energy.
Heat pumps, air conditioning, heat recovery.
Ecological trends in automotive transport.
Technology of production of energy from the core.
Regular, low-energy and passive houses.
